Pronase digestion of human IgG and Fcδ

1979 
Abstract The susceptibility of human Fcδ and IgG to proteolysis with pronase under conditions similar to those used for the removal of Ig from lymphocyte membranes has been studied. This treatment did not effect proteolysis of the Fcδ fragment but the IgG was rapidly digested to yield Fab, Fc and Fc' fragments. The Fab fragment is resistant to further proteolysis but the Fc and Fc' fragments are progressively degraded to small peptides. The Fc and Fc' products isolated from a 3 hr digest were shown to be composed of residues 225 (Thr)-466 (Glu) and 345 (Glu)-432 (Ala). Implications of these findings for the mode of action of enzyme removal of lymphocyte membrane Ig are discussed.
